How to Choose a Mini Projector Floor Stand

1. Check Compatibility and Mounting Type

The most crucial step is confirming your projector has a standard 1/4-inch threaded screw hole on its bottom. Nearly all stands in this category use this mount. Verify the hole’s location is centered for optimal balance. Some stands, like the Projector Stand Tripod Laptop Stands Height, feature a large tray, which can accommodate devices without a screw hole, offering more versatility.

2. Prioritize Stability and Weight Capacity

A stand must securely hold your projector without shaking. Look for a heavy base, often made of metal, and a stated load capacity well above your projector’s weight. The Projector Stand, 33LB Load Bearing & 22-55″ Height offers exceptional support for heavier mini projectors or combined setups with speakers. Anti-slip pads on the base are essential for protecting floors and preventing movement.

3. Evaluate Height and Angle Adjustability

<!–

Your ideal screen height depends on your seating and room layout. Measure from your eye level to the floor where the stand will sit. Choose a stand with a height range that covers this measurement. A ball head that offers 360-degree swivel and at least 90 degrees of tilt, like on the ZDSSY model, provides maximum flexibility for wall or ceiling projection without moving the base.

4. Consider Portability and Footprint

If you plan to move the stand between rooms or take it outdoors, portability is key. Look for foldable, lightweight tripod designs like the Projector Floor Stand, Portable Tripod Mount. For a permanent living room setup, a sleek L-shaped stand with a smaller base, such as the PUTORSEN models, can tuck neatly behind furniture and save space. Frequently Asked Questions

Will a floor stand work with my specific projector brand?

Most mini projectors from popular brands like XGIMI, Nebula, Anker, and Vankyo have a standard 1/4-inch screw hole. Always double-check your projector’s manual or bottom panel. Stands like the jusmo LS09 are explicitly marketed for compatibility with these major brands. You can also compare projector models in our guide to the best high-brightness mini projectors.

How do I prevent the projector from shaking on the stand?

Ensure all knobs and locks on the stand’s extension poles and ball head are fully tightened. Place the stand on a flat, level surface and use a stand with a wide, weighted base for the best stability. Avoid extending the stand to its maximum height if your projector is heavy, as this can increase leverage and potential wobble.

Can I use these stands for anything other than a projector?

Absolutely. These stands are incredibly versatile. With the universal 1/4-inch screw, you can mount cameras for video calls, webcams, ring lights for streaming, or even small speakers. Models with a large flat tray can hold laptops, tablets, or small monitors, making them excellent for creating ergonomic standing desks.

What is the main difference between an L-shaped stand and a tripod stand?

An L-shaped stand typically has a single vertical column with a rectangular or square base. It offers a smaller footprint and a modern look, ideal for permanent placement in living areas. A tripod stand has three legs, which often provides superior stability on uneven surfaces and is generally more portable and easier to fold down for storage or transport.
